4. Qualities of a Mathematics Textbook
The qualities of a good textbook in
mathematics can be broadly
classified under the following heads
• 1. Physical features
• 2. Author
• 3. Content
• 4. Organization and
presentations
• 5. Language
• 6. Exercise and illustration
• 7. General
5. 1. Physical features:
1. Paper: the paper used in the textbook should
be of superior quality
2. Binding: it should have quality strong and
durable binding
3. Printing: it should have quality printing, bold
font and easily readable font.
4. Size: bulky and thick. It should be handy
5. Cover: it should have an appealing and
attractive cover page.
6. 2. Author:
1. Qualified author should write it
2. Experienced teacher should write it
3. Competent teachers should write it
4. It should be written by committee of experts
constituted by the state government
5. For the authors, certain minimum academic and
professional qualifications may be prescribed.
7. 3. Content
1. It should be child centered
2. The subject matter should be arranged from simple to
complex and concrete to abstracts.
3. The subject matter should create interest in the pupil.
4. It should be objective oriented
5. It should be written according to prescribed syllabus
6. It should satisfy the demands of examination
7. The answers given at the end of each section should be
correct
8. It should include the recent developments in the
mathematics relating to the content dealt with.
9. Oral mathematics should fine its due place in the
textbook.
8. 4. Organization and presentation
1. It should provide for individual differences.
2. There should be sufficient provision for revision, practice
and review.
3. It should stimulate the initiative and originality of the
students
4. It should offer suggestion to improve study habits.
5. It should facilitate the use of analytic, synthetic, inductive,
deductive, problem solving and heuristic approaches to
teaching.
6. Content should be organize in a psychological
consideration
7. Content should be organize in a logical way
8. It should suggesting project work, fieldwork and
laboratory work.
9. 5. Language
1. The language used in the textbook should be
simple and easily understandable and within the
grasp of the pupils
2. The style and vocabulary used should be
suitable to the age group of student for whom
the book is written.
3. The term and symbols used must be those,
which are popular and internationally accepted
4. It should be written in lucid, simple, precise and
scientific language.
10. 6. Exercise and Illustrations:
1. The illustrations should be accurate
2. The illustrations should be clear and appropriate
3. It should contain some difficult problems
4. It should contain exercises to challenge the
mathematically gifted students.
5. There should be well-graded exercises given at
the end of every topic.
6. The exercise should develop thinking and
reasoning power of the pupils.
11. 7. General:
• At the end of book there should be tables and
appendices.
• The textbook should be of latest edition with
necessary modifications
The book should be moderate price and
readily available in the marker.
